Job Summary

Join UT Southwestern as a Materials Technician for the Cancer Center Outpatient building. The Materials Technician works under general supervision to provide technical skills required to receive and transport materials and supplies throughout campus.

This position does require candidates to have a valid State of Texas Driver's License.

Starting pay is $18.00 per hour.

Required Experience and Education

  • High school graduation or equivalent and prior experience working on computers using ERP / WMS platforms.
  • Must be able to lift / move 75 lbs.
  • Must have possession of valid State of Texas motor vehicle operator's license when required by employing department.

Preferred experience includes : Experience using Microsoft office products; use of Fork lift, Electric Pallet Jacks and Manual Pallet Jacks.

A Commercial Driver's License or ability to obtain license within a specified time may be required if operating certain vehicles.

Job Duties

Unloads FedEx, UPS and Common Carrier trailers; inspects merchandise for damage; gathers pack lists and pertinent information to accurately determine recipient;

and generates receiving documents and receipts.

Process all boxes, cartons, envelopes and vendor shipping containers using computer to enter information from purchase orders and memos;

generates and attaches barcode tracking labels.

  • Problem solves PO's that cannot be processed due to missing information (20% of responsibilities if working at exception desk).
  • Assist and direct customer related phone calls that are received on phone in proximity.
  • Enters receiving information from receiving reports into PeopleSoft or SC Logistics delivery system and sorts completed work onto appropriate skid for delivery.
  • Delivers merchandise using fleet truck by loading and off-loading merchandise from trucks using variety of means including forklifts, pallet jacks, and manual loading techniques.
  • Restocks General Stores with product in correct bin locations and picks customer orders with correct product and correct quantity.
  • Utilizes computer printout sheet and / or handheld device to determine, document and replenished supply quantities. Completes cycle counting and inventory adjustments.
  • Answers department phone and resolves phone related issues in a timely and professional manner.
  • May help train less experienced Material Technicians.
  • Ensures storage areas and stock rooms are maintained in clean and tidy condition.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
